Aub, Ala, LSU, UT, Fla, UGA have won every SEC title since 1976 when UK shared it w/ UGA. You have to go back to 1963 to find a school not in the big 6 to win it outright (Ole Miss). Every one of those 6 are a conference and national power although obviously they are never all up at once bc they basically can't be. It's one of the reasons the league is so good, depth of powerhouse programs. Vandy is the worst team in the league (not at the moment, historically).
